- What water parameters should I track in a reef tank?
- The core reef parameters to track are salinity, temperature, pH, alkalinity (dKH), calcium, and magnesium, plus the nutrients nitrate and phosphate. Stability matters more than chasing perfect numbers — The Reef Lab charts each parameter over time so you can see trends and consumption rather than relying on single readings.
